Do I need to customize to use SafeSide’s teachings?

No. SafeSide’s programs and offerings are used in organizations as is and are designed to engage, unite, and support diverse workforces, serving diverse populations in diverse locations to think, act, and communicate with common principles and best practices.

But for organizations that require a more tailored learning experience, SafeSide Prevention’s instructional design and video production team (called the InPlace Productions team) partners with collaborating entities to fund and tailor content to ensure maximum relevance and learning transfer for your setting, population, and culture.
